The Importance Of Electrical Maintenance Testing

electrical maintenance testing is a critical aspect of keeping electrical systems in optimal condition. This type of testing involves evaluating the functionality and safety of electrical equipment, circuits, and components to ensure they are working properly and to prevent potential dangers such as electrocution, fires, and equipment breakdowns. By conducting regular electrical maintenance testing, businesses and homeowners can identify and address issues before they escalate into major problems.

One of the primary reasons to perform electrical maintenance testing is to ensure compliance with safety regulations and standards. Most countries have specific regulations in place that require periodic testing of electrical systems to prevent accidents and injuries. Failure to comply with these regulations can result in fines, penalties, and legal consequences. By staying on top of maintenance testing, individuals and organizations can avoid these issues and promote a safe working environment.

Additionally, electrical maintenance testing can help prolong the lifespan of electrical equipment and prevent costly breakdowns. Regular testing can identify potential issues such as loose connections, worn-out components, and overloading, which, if left unaddressed, can lead to equipment failures and downtime. By proactively addressing these issues through maintenance testing, businesses can extend the lifespan of their electrical systems and avoid unexpected repair costs.

Another benefit of electrical maintenance testing is improved energy efficiency. Over time, electrical systems can become inefficient due to factors such as dust accumulation, wear and tear, and outdated components. By conducting regular maintenance testing, individuals and organizations can identify and address issues that are impacting the efficiency of their electrical systems. This, in turn, can help reduce energy consumption, lower utility bills, and improve overall operational efficiency.

Furthermore, electrical maintenance testing can help enhance overall system reliability. By identifying and correcting issues before they escalate, businesses can minimize the risk of unexpected failures and downtime. This is particularly important for critical systems that cannot afford to experience disruptions, such as data centers, healthcare facilities, and manufacturing plants. By conducting regular maintenance testing, businesses can ensure that their electrical systems are operating reliably and are less likely to experience costly interruptions.

When it comes to electrical maintenance testing, there are several key procedures and techniques that are commonly used. One of the most common tests is insulation resistance testing, which measures the resistance of electrical insulation to prevent current leakage and electrical hazards. Another important test is the continuity test, which checks for breaks or discontinuities in electrical circuits. Other tests include earth fault loop impedance testing, polarity testing, and operation testing, among others.
